Output fae68558f261fbceafb99bd3a666bdcdc72bda9e8cdcdf03e4bcd3c0b57e293a:121

value
101130
script pubkey
OP_0 OP_PUSHBYTES_20 0d5983eb4d04dc27e14bf5718b590b498c260ccd
address
bc1qp4vc866dqnwz0c2t74cckkgtfxxzvrxdly30yk
transaction
fae68558f261fbceafb99bd3a666bdcdc72bda9e8cdcdf03e4bcd3c0b57e293a
confirmations
29766
spent
true